Wolff worries about toll of triple-headers on team personnel

Mercedes boss Toto Wolff says that he is concerned about the human cost of running more triple-header events in 2021. The sport has traditionally avoided running three Grand Prix races on consecutive weekends, but was forced into an unprecedented four such runs when the start of the season was delayed to July by the onset of coronavirus. Recognising the extraordinary circumstances, teams went along with it this season. But many have been dismayed to see two more triple-headers appear on the provisional 23-race schedule for next year.
